James Franco has been many things: a movie actor, a soap star, a film director, a painter, and a grad student (at four universities, all at the same time!).
Now, according to a press release, the irrepressible Mr. Franco is both a college course and one of the instructors:
Academy Award-nominated actor James Franco has partnered with Columbia College Hollywood to offer an innovative course through which 12 of the private film school’s best editing students will create a 30 minute documentary film from videographic footage from Mr. Franco’s own unorthodox career.
“Master Class: Editing James Franco…with James Franco” breaks new ground in higher education. Can anyone recall another course where the professor is also the subject of study?
